Established in 1872, this is the oldest public park in the country and its first public garden. Following the events of 1878, the space was significantly redesigned by architect Antonín Kolář on the initiative of governor Pyotr Alabin. Originally named the Alexander II Garden in honor of Alexander II, the site was reorganized with an updated alley network, new plant species, a wooden fence, a coffeehouse, and a kiosk for musicians.
The park features central fountains and is a recognized site for outdoor chess games. The grounds are positioned in front of the Ivan Vazov National Theatre and the former royal palace, surrounded by various cultural and state institutions.
